Before 1952 Season: Signed by the Brooklyn Dodgers as an amateur free agent.

October 19, 1959: Traded by the Los Angeles Dodgers to the Baltimore Orioles for $50,000. The Baltimore Orioles sent Willy Miranda (March 15, 1960) and Bill Lajoie (minors) (March 15, 1960) to the Los Angeles Dodgers to complete the trade.

November 27, 1963: Traded by the Baltimore Orioles with $25,000 to the Kansas City Athletics for Norm Siebern.

June 4, 1965: Traded by the Kansas City Athletics to the Houston Astros for Jesse Hickman. The Houston Astros sent Ernie Fazio (October 15, 1965) to the Kansas City Athletics to complete the trade.

July 19, 1966: Traded by the Houston Astros to the Cleveland Indians for Tony Curry.
